    Interesting that there is no mention of Iceland, which is where my father's family came from (by way of Denmark 500 years earlier). You can still find the Wium surname in the Reykjavík phone book, though there are more in Akureyri. Because the name has Danish roots no "son" or dottir" is added. There are also some Wium's in South Africa.

    This site doesn't count Iceland in. I typed my surname, but it only showed the other Nordic pupulation who bear it but not Iceland. The -son and -dóttir names are not family names, because your fathers name comes before the -son or -dóttir. If you are a woman and your father's name is Kristján, for example, your last name would be Kristjánsdóttir( daughter of Kristján) ,however, if you ware a man your last name would be Kristjánsson (son of Kristján). But on the other hand, -sen can sometimes be a familyname because -sen is the ending of some nordic family names and some people have those , for example the soccer player Eidur Gudjohnsen wich plays with FC Barcelona. His father's name isn't Gudjohn so thats a family name. Most people here only have the -son or dóttir name and not family names.

    I know I'm going into another subject but I just wanted to tell you how the surnames work here in Iceland
